The Growth of Cross-Device Gaming
The progression towards gaming across multiple platforms has been a steady and transformative process extending over many years. Initially, gaming existed in isolated ecosystems, with players limited to specific device manufacturers and their proprietary systems. However, technical innovations and rising demand from consumers for flexibility prompted developers to reassess conventional limitations. The shift began with early online multiplayer games that showed the potential of linking various systems, establishing the foundation for the complex framework we see today.
Throughout the 2010s, leading game developers began investing heavily in cross-platform compatibility, identifying the commercial and social benefits. Games such as Fortnite and Minecraft established smooth connectivity across PlayStation, Xbox, Nintendo, PC, and mobile platforms, creating novel industry norms. This period witnessed significant engineering leaps in cloud technology and unified data standards, allowing creators to develop fully connected gaming experiences. The success of these titles proved that cross-platform functionality was not merely a novelty but a core requirement amongst contemporary players.

Technical Infrastructure Behind Uninterrupted Gaming
The backbone of cross-platform gaming relies on complex server architecture and cloud computing systems that sync player data instantly across disparate devices and operating systems. These robust networks utilise sophisticated APIs and middleware solutions to convert commands from various input methods—keyboards, controllers, and touchscreens—into integrated game logic. By establishing standard protocols and leveraging content delivery networks, developers ensure low lag and stable performance, irrespective of whether players access through broadband or mobile networks, establishing a seamless competitive environment.
Login mechanisms form another critical component, utilising unified account management to monitor player progress, achievements, and inventory throughout all devices simultaneously. Encryption technologies safeguard sensitive information whilst permitting instant synchronisation between devices. Furthermore, matchmaking algorithms intelligently balance player skill levels and network performance, guaranteeing equitable gameplay irrespective of platform choice. These interconnected systems work harmoniously behind the scenes, allowing gamers to transition effortlessly between their PC, console, or smartphone without sacrificing progress or competitive standing, substantially enhancing the gaming experience.
Advantages for Professional Esports
Cross-platform gaming has substantially reshaped competitive gaming by eradicating device-based barriers that once divided player communities. Players can now engage in tournaments, ranked matches, and casual competitions irrespective of their chosen hardware, creating larger, more diverse player pools. This expanded accessibility bolsters the competitive ecosystem, cultivating healthier matchmaking systems and more engaging esports experiences. The removal of platform restrictions has opened up competitive gaming, enabling skilled players from all backgrounds to compete fairly and establish themselves within global gaming communities.
Improved Player Participation and Retention
Multi-device compatibility significantly enhances user participation by offering adaptability in how and where players engage. Players can seamlessly transition between devices without forfeiting advancement, achievements, or competitive standings, encouraging more frequent gameplay sessions. This convenience factor directly contributes to improved retention rates, as players appreciate the ability to compete during commutes, breaks, or whilst at home. The ongoing availability provided through cross-platform features creates habit-forming gaming experiences that keep players invested in their favourite titles over prolonged timeframes.
The community dimension of multi-platform gaming further amplifies player retention and engagement metrics. Friends separated by device preferences can now game together seamlessly, reinforcing connections within gaming communities. Guilds, clans, and competitive teams operate more cohesively when participation isn’t restricted by device restrictions. This welcoming setting builds stronger emotional connections to games, encouraging players to keep their accounts active and invest in their gaming experiences long-term.
